Ajax Amsterdam are one of 20 teams across Europe that want Barcelona starlet Adama Traore on loan.

The Amsterdam side can offer not only first team football, but also Champions league action to the 18 year old which will help the youngster in his development.
In fact the Spanish youth international made his only UEFA Champions League appearance against the club when he came on as a substitute in a 2-1 loss to Ajax. In addition to that he has played in one La Liga match for the Catalan club, a 4-0 win over Granada.
In order to land the winger Ajax will have to ward off interest from half the La Liga sides and a host of Premier League clubs including Manchester United, Southampton, Stoke City and Everton.
However Ajax have a good relationship with Barcelona having recently loaned both Isaac Cuenca, and Bojan from the Spanish giants.
